The object of the game is to herd sheep through the dip and into the pen. One player controls the farmer and his 2 dogs. One or more other players control sheep that try to stay out of the dip and pen. Play occurs on a grid of 18 by 18 squares. Hedges, bushes, fences and water hazards impede movement. The farmer may move vertical, horizontal, or diagonal. The dogs and sheep move only vertical or horizontal. The farmer moves the total of the throw of three dice and can divide his movement between himself and the two dogs. The sheep use one die, and cannot move next to the farmer or dogs or through natural obstacles. When the farmer or dogs move next to a sheep it forces the sheep to move away. The farmer also has additional fences that he place to block movement.

Although components are not included, complete rules were published in Games and Puzzles Magazine no. 5. It is suitable for miniatures play using model railroad accessories on a ruled grid.
